LARS,a.k.a. the LAST AMERICAN ROCK STARS – featuring rap icon Bizarre of D12 fame and Detroit horrorcore shock rapper King Gordy – are about to own 2018. LARS will release their debut full-length album, Last American Rock Stars, on February 16, 2018 via expanding Detroit-based rap label Majik Ninja Entertainment. The long-awaited, highly-anticipated album is available for pre-order here via major digital retailers, or in several exclusive physical format merch bundles at www.MNEStore.com.   

Last American Rock Stars is as eclectic and wild as the duo behind it – featuring 13 all new tracks exploring genres all over the map – like the smooth throwback R&B-inspired jam “Cocaine in Miami”, the addictive reggae anthem “Ganja Man”, aggressive club bangers like “Lit”, and more.

After dropping a mixtape last fall that spawned their breakout track “L.A.R.S.“, the duo is following up with the premiere of “Lit”. The video is just that – depicting LARS living out true rock star visions and raging hard at an unruly metal show. It doesn’t take long before King Gordy gets into some serious trouble. LARS signed to expanding independent rap label Majik Ninja Entertainment last summer after recording demos at the label’s studio with renowned Detroit rap producer Foul Mouth. After label owners TWIZTID heard the demos and saw the immediate potential in the project, there was no question in their minds that they had to sign LARS. The duo spawned from the same neighborhood in Detroit that both members grew up in (King Gordy was even featured in the famed Detroit-based movie 8 Mile starring Eminem). TWIZTID has been tight with LARS for years, having recorded tracks together and even performing together in Atlanta earlier this year.
